1. Enhanced Safety Measures
One of the most significant benefits of using On-Site Nitrogen & Gas Systems for Battery & Lithium Industry is the enhancement of safety measures. In battery manufacturing, flammable materials and gases pose risks. By creating an inert atmosphere using nitrogen, manufacturers can greatly reduce fire hazards. This solution effectively mitigates risks, ensuring the safety of employees and facilities.

4. Quality Control
Using On-Site Nitrogen & Gas Systems ensures higher quality control standards in battery production. The consistent quality of the inert atmosphere used in manufacturing batteries helps to prevent oxidation and contamination. These systems provide a controlled environment that is crucial for the efficiency and longevity of battery products.
